## Environments: Brackenfold build migration

Brackenfold now builds under the hermetic Oxcart system in staging; prod cutover is next sprint. Network access during builds is blocked, so vendored deps only. If a support escalation mentions missing artifacts, check the Oxcart cache first. Staging builds currently run with the following configuration values.

service settings:
[silwyn]
host = silwyn.crelvogrid.internal
user = silwyn_svc
database = silwyn_prod

# Artifact Signing — Notifier Fan-out

Heads up, reviewer: the Pulsewick notifier now applies backpressure when fan-out exceeds 500 msg/s per shard, so the signing job can stall if the queue backs up. We sign the fan-out config bundle itself now, since a bad config caused last month's flood. Check that the bundle hash matches the build log before approving. The bundle gets verified against this key:

rollout seal: bky4_x7Gc

Handover from Marit to Deven, for plugin authors on the Snapdrift platform. EXIF scrubbing now runs in the ingest worker before any plugin hook fires, so your plugins will never see GPS or serial-number tags. If you need orientation data, read the normalized rotation field instead; raw EXIF is gone by design. Exceptions for forensic plugins require an allowlist entry. The allowlist process and tag reference live on the page below.

wiki page, bagaf-fawip: https://harbor.tolvaqsys.local/pages/repo/pages/secrets/eac969ffc71f356b

The Lintvane static-analysis baseline file is owned by a dedicated service account so contractors can't mutate it directly. If that account locks — common after the quarterly credential sweep — the baseline stops updating and every pull request gets flagged against stale findings.

As a contractor you can run the recovery yourself. Open the Lintvane admin shell, run the unlock command against the baseline-owner account, and confirm the prompt. The shell will then ask for the recovery passphrase, which is recorded immediately below.

strongbox words: sorir-belvan-rusix-ulays-ralmir-praix-eliir-tamax-praael-druael-julir-tamius-jorir